Stefan and Gabrielle share a strong international background having lived variously in Stockholm, Krakow, Rome. Montreal, New York, London and Los Angeles, with appropriate language skills. They hold degrees from Columbia College and both UCLA and Yale School of Drama. They have directed and/or produced 5 films (2 features), 500 stage productions including 30 Brecht plays and 40 Shakespeare productions.
Stefan has produced, directed and/or executive produced nearly 3,000 audiobooks for Skyboat Audio and major publishers including Audible, Inc., Blackstone Audio, Dove Audio, MacMillan Audio, Random House Audio Publishing Group and Zondervan. He has narrated hundreds of audiobooks, including non-fiction titles Hubris, Legacy of Ashes and Deep Survival, and multiple fiction titles by Orson Scott Card (Ender, etc.), Charles McCarry, Alex Bledsoe, Ben Bova, Alan Dean Foster (Pip and Flinx), David Webber/John Ringo and Louie L'Amour.
Gabrielle has narrated close to one hundred titles specializing in fantasy, humor and titles requiring extensive foreign language and accent skills. Her "velvet touch" as an actor's director has earned her a special place in the audiobook world as the foremost director for best-selling authors and celebrities. Short list of those directed: Carl Reiner, Deepak Chopra, Eric Idle, Nancy Cartwright, Michael York, Ed Herrmann and Joe Mantegna.
They recently produced Go The Fuck To Sleep read by Samuel Jackson (Audible.com.)
